Mission: To help empower and enable children to resist the ever-increasing pressures responsible for the record levels of campus killings, adolescent suicide, depression, dropouts, incarcerations, and acts of violence among youth in the us today.
Programs: Fye14 saw a dramatic shift in our program, stemming from the dec. 14, 2012, sandy hook massacre, new town, ct, resulting in the murder of 20 elementary school children and six staff. Given that tragic situation and the new heightened public understanding of the urgency of such concerns nationwide, for which we've been advocating since inception, the campaign for american kids (cak) launched a concerted effort to make key decision makers in ct aware of the solution we'd created. On november 15, 2013, cak finally secured trademark rights for name veracare america, which has become our signature program. Veracare was designed to make low cost, yet superior quality child development/daycare services available to those who would benefit most, with a view ultimately to maximizing security and well-being for the whole of american society. Efforts in bringing veracare to ct were mostly volunteer-driven, under the leadership of rev. Jesse glick. Rev. Glick created an all-volunteer, ad hoc state advisory team, and succeeded in generating numerous valuable relationships. These include congregation and communion executives, the public education advocacy team (peat), edward f zigler phd, sterling prof emeritus psychology; emeritus faculty; director, emeritus, the edward zigler center in child development & social policy, senators chris murphy and dante bartolomeo, the ucc women of connecticut, and the connecticut coalition for children. Rev. Glick also arranged for a december meeting with newly-hired myra jones taylor, phd, director, connecticut office of early childhood and cak board members. He also assured that our organization and its mission were visible at the ucc annual conference in hartford.
